Egypt players watch Real Madrid clip before penalty shootout to study Australian goalkeeper

Before their World Cup round of 16 match against Australia, Egypt's players improvised by watching a Real Madrid match on a laptop to analyze the movement of Australian goalkeeper Mathew Ryan. The tactic worked: Egypt scored all their penalties and advanced.

In a unique preparation for the penalty shootout against Australia in the World Cup round of 16, Egypt's players gathered around a laptop to watch a Real Madrid match. Their target: studying the movements of Australian goalkeeper Mathew Ryan, who had played in that match.

The improvisation paid off. Egypt successfully converted all of their penalty kicks, eliminating Australia from the tournament. With the victory, Egypt advanced to the quarterfinals, where they will face either Argentina or Cape Verde.

The 2026 World Cup is the first edition to feature 48 teams, divided into 12 groups. The top two from each group, along with the eight best third-placed teams, qualify for the knockout stage. The group stage ends on June 27, with knockout matches starting June 28. Semifinals are scheduled for July 14 and 15, the bronze medal match on July 18, and the final on July 19.

The previous World Cup in 2022, held in Qatar, was won by Argentina, who defeated France in a penalty shootout in the final.
